Magnetointersubband resistance oscillations in GaAs quantum wells placed in a tilted magnetic field

Abstract: The magnetotransport of highly mobile 2D electrons in wide GaAs single quantum wells with three populated subbands placed in titled magnetic fields is studied. The bottoms of the lower two subbands have nearly the same energy while the bottom of the third subband has a much higher energy (E1 ≈ E2 << E3). At zero in-plane magnetic fields magneto-intersubband oscillations (MISO) between the i th and j th subbands are observed and obey the relation ∆ij = Ej −Ei = k·hωc, where ωc is the cyclotron frequency and k i… Show more
